What is the history of which arm to wear a bracelet?
Normally, a person wears the bracelet on the opposite arm of their writing. But it is not really important. Where did it start the tradition?
It is not that complicated. You wear the watch on your nondominant hand, because you do not want it to break or get in the way while you do things with the dominant hand.
